Guide to Health Hazards of Transite Pipe Cement-asbestos Water PipingTransite pipe or asbestos-cement pipes were used for water supply systems in some municipalities up into the 1970's in the U.S. and probably in other countries. In some cities (Ellwood PA for example), the transite water mains were found to be unable to reliably withstand high water pressures (up to 225 psi in Ellwood according to one of our readers) and the pipes were easily broken. Asbestos fibers may be ingested from water supplied through transite water piping. Transite piping deteriorates over time, releasing asbestos fibers from the interior of the pipe into the drinking water flowing through that conduit. Practical Hazards & Risks of Transite Water Supply Piping MainsLeaks in transite water supply piping underground can result in substantial water losses in districts where this piping was used. Locating transite water supply mains: We've been informed that excavators complain that its lack of metal makes locating transite water pipes difficult - one cannot use ordinary metal detectors. Of course a buried pipe of non-metallic material might be located if it is possible to insert a sending probe inside its length but on a water main this procedure is impractical. Contractors joke that they find transite pipe by using the metal bucket of a backhoe as a pipe detector. Replacement costs for transite water supply piping: because of its age, leaks, fragility, and difficulty of finding transite cement asbestos water supply mains and water piping without also damaging it at the same time, owners of properties and communities served by cement asbestos water pipes (transite) can expect to face increasing costs to replace that piping. asbestos fiber release hazards during removal of demolition of transite piping are discussed at Transite Pipe Chimneys & Flues.
